Street Food Burger: Pushing the Boundaries of Burger Innovation Spain – A podcast clip featuring El Hombre Descalzo interviewing Manuel Rodríguez, owner of Street Food Burger, has sparked conversation about the limits of culinary innovation. The interview delves into Rodríguez's unique approach to burger creation, highlighting his use of unconventional ingredients like Goblin potatoes. "It's about finding a balance," Rodríguez explains, "You can't just throw everything into a burger. People still want a cohesive experience." He emphasizes the importance of respecting traditional elements while pushing creative boundaries. The interview also touches on the challenges of maintaining quality control when experimenting with novel ingredients and flavors.
